PD014 - PREOPERATIVE MALNUTRITION ASSESSED BY GLIM BUT NOT PG-SGA PREDICTS PROLONGED HOSPITAL STAY FOLLOWING GASTROINTESTINAL SURGERY

Rationale: Preoperative malnutrition may delay postoperative recovery and prolong hospital stay. This study compared GLIM and PG-SGA in predicting postoperative ward length of stay (LOS).

Methods: A prospective observational study was conducted among 86 patients undergoing major gastrointestinal surgery at National Hospital Kandy. Nutritional status was assessed preoperatively using GLIM and PG-SGA. Patients were categorized as well-nourished or malnourished.

Postoperative ward LOS was recorded (mean 10.6 ± 3.87 days; median 10 days). LOS was analyzed as both a continuous variable and categorized into early vs delayed discharge. Associations between nutritional status and LOS were assessed using chi-square tests (p<0.05 significant).

Results: Malnutrition prevalence was 73.3% by GLIM and 77.9% by PG-SGA.

GLIM-defined malnourished patients had significantly prolonged LOS compared to well-nourished patients, with median LOS exceeding 10 days and some stays extending up to 27 days (χ² = 27.484, p = 0.011).

Although PG-SGA–defined malnourished patients showed a trend toward longer LOS, this was not statistically significant (χ² = 15.610, p = 0.271), with overlapping LOS distributions between groups.

Conclusion: GLIM-defined malnutrition was significantly associated with prolonged postoperative hospital stay, whereas PG-SGA was not predictive. GLIM may be a more effective tool for identifying patients at risk of delayed recovery following gastrointestinal surgery.
